Join a rapidly growing team as Director within Walker & Dunlop's EMEA Hotels Investment & Sales practice in London. The Director is a leadership role responsible for originating and executing hotel capital markets transactions across the UK and EMEA. Working closely with the Managing Director, the Director will lead client engagements, transaction execution, investor outreach, underwriting, and business development efforts while mentoring junior professionals and helping drive the continued growth of the platform. In a lean, high-performing team, your execution quality and commercial instincts will be visible from day one.

Primary Responsibilities
 

  • Identify, pursue, and originate new business opportunities across hotel investment sales, debt advisory, equity placement, recapitalizations, and M&A assignments.
  • Develop and maintain senior-level relationships with hotel owners, operators, institutional investors, private equity firms, lenders, family offices, and other key market participants throughout EMEA.
  • Lead transaction execution from mandate through closing, including underwriting, due diligence coordination, investor marketing, negotiation support, and completion processes.
  • Oversee the preparation and presentation of pitch materials, investment memoranda, financing memoranda, financial models, market analyses, and transaction recommendations.
  • Analyze acquisition, disposition, refinancing, recapitalization, and strategic alternatives for clients across a range of hospitality assets and portfolios.
  • Lead investor and lender outreach processes, coordinating targeted marketing campaigns and managing stakeholder communications throughout transactions.
  • Evaluate market trends, capital flows, operating performance metrics, and investment opportunities within the hospitality sector to provide strategic advice to clients.
  • Work closely with the Managing Director to develop business plans, market coverage strategies, and revenue growth initiatives for the EMEA Hotels platform.
  • Manage multiple active mandates simultaneously while maintaining exceptional quality standards and client service.
  • Lead, mentor, and develop Associate Directors, Senior Analysts, Analysts, and other junior team members.
  • Coordinate staffing and resource allocation across transactions, ensuring efficient execution and professional development opportunities for team members.
  • Contribute to thought leadership, industry visibility, and Walker & Dunlop brand development through conferences, client meetings, and market engagement.

Education And Experience
 

  • Bachelor's degree required; preference for finance, real estate, economics, hospitality, or related disciplines.
  • 7+ years of commercial real estate and/or hospitality capital markets experience.
  • Demonstrated experience in hotel investment sales, hospitality advisory, debt placement, equity raising, investment banking, or related capital markets disciplines.
  • Proven track record of managing and executing complex hospitality transactions.
  • Existing network of hospitality investors, owners, lenders, operators, and capital providers within the UK and broader EMEA market strongly preferred.
  • Experience leading client relationships and participating in business development initiatives.
  • CFA, MRICS, CCIM, or equivalent professional designation preferred.
  • Additional European language skills (French, German, Spanish, Italian, or others) are advantageous.
  • Eligible to work in the United Kingdom
